WebOct 29, 2024 · If the A-a gradient is within normal range, the cause of the hypoxemia is due to hypoventilation (elevated PaCO 2) or a low barometric pressure (high elevations). Remember, since the A-a gradient uses … The A–a gradient is useful in determining the source of hypoxemia. The measurement helps isolate the location of the problem as either intrapulmonary (within the lungs) or extrapulmonary (elsewhere in the body). A normal A–a gradient for a young adult non-smoker breathing air, is between 5–10 mmHg. Normally, the A–a gradient increases with age. For every decade a person has lived, their A–a …
